Hier werden die Unterschiede zwischen zwei Versionen angezeigt.
Nächste Überarbeitung | Vorhergehende Überarbeitung | ||
software:tim:actionhandler:callsqlfunction [2013/07/15 14:15] fabian.tagsold angelegt |
software:tim:actionhandler:callsqlfunction [2021/07/01 09:52] (aktuell) |
||
---|---|---|---|
Zeile 1: | Zeile 1: | ||
+ | =========CallSqlFunction======== | ||
==== Beschreibung ==== | ==== Beschreibung ==== | ||
Dieser Handler kann als ActionHandler oder DecisionHandler verwendet werden!\\ | Dieser Handler kann als ActionHandler oder DecisionHandler verwendet werden!\\ | ||
Zeile 4: | Zeile 5: | ||
ActionHandler:\\ | ActionHandler:\\ | ||
Ruft eine auf der Datenbank abgelegte MySQL Function mit beliebigen Parametern auf und schreibt den Rückgabewert in eine Prozessvariable.\\ | Ruft eine auf der Datenbank abgelegte MySQL Function mit beliebigen Parametern auf und schreibt den Rückgabewert in eine Prozessvariable.\\ | ||
- | Falls das Ergebniss null ist, kann ein Defaultwert angegeben werden.\\ | + | Falls das Ergebnis null ist, kann ein Defaultwert angegeben werden.\\ |
\\ | \\ | ||
DecisionHandler:\\ | DecisionHandler:\\ | ||
Zeile 13: | Zeile 14: | ||
==== Klasse ==== | ==== Klasse ==== | ||
<code> | <code> | ||
- | com.dooris.bpm.db.CallSqlFunction | + | com.dooris.bpm.actionhandler.CallSqlFunctionHandler |
</code> | </code> | ||
\\ | \\ | ||
Zeile 51: | Zeile 52: | ||
==== Beispiel ==== | ==== Beispiel ==== | ||
ActionHandler:\\ | ActionHandler:\\ | ||
- | {{ :software:tim:actionhandler:callsqlfunction_actionhandler.jpg?nolink |}} | + | {{ :software:tim:actionhandler:callsqlfunctionhandler1.png }} |
\\ | \\ | ||
\\ | \\ | ||
DecisionHandler:\\ | DecisionHandler:\\ | ||
- | {{ :software:tim:actionhandler:callsqlfunction_decisionhandler_1.jpg?nolink |}} | + | {{ :software:tim:actionhandler:callsqlfunctionhandler2.png |}} |
- | \\ | + | |
- | {{ :software:tim:actionhandler:callsqlfunction_decisionhandler_2.jpg?nolink |}} | + | |
---- | ---- |